As nouns, astronavigation is a hyponym of pilotage; that is, astronavigation is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than pilotage:
  • pilotage: the guidance of ships or airplanes from place to place
  • astronavigation: navigating according to the positions of the stars
Other hyponyms of pilotage include instrument flying, celestial navigation, dead reckoning.
